Vladyslav Vlasiuk, Ukraine's sanctions policy commissioner, stated in Singapore that sanctions are the most effective means of compelling Moscow to engage in serious peace talks. He noted that components found in missile debris shot down in the Kyiv region primarily originated from the United States, Russia, China, Taiwan, and Japan. Vlasiuk plans to meet with officials from Malaysia, Indonesia, Japan, and Thailand during his Asia trip to discuss Russia's "shadow fleet" and the flow of microelectronics into its defense industry.
